Handover for TogglePath. Rollouts are percentage-based; config lives in the control plane, synced every 60s. Don't edit flags directly in the store — use the CLI, it validates dependencies. Known issue: stale cache on the edge nodes after bulk updates; workaround is a forced refresh. Kill switch is the global freeze flag. If the admin console locks you out, the recovery flow needs the team passphrase before it restores write access. New folks, memorize it, don't paste it in chat. The passphrase is:

vault phrase of tajef-tafog = istox-sorax-zorox-casok-holox-kelix-weneth-drueth-casion

### Action Item 3: Bound Incremental Rebuild Fan-out

The Pressfield site outage happened because one shared template invalidated every page, and our incremental rebuilder treated that as 12,000 independent jobs. Reviewer, please confirm the new batching logic collapses template-wide invalidations into a single full rebuild once the dirty count crosses the threshold, and that the debounce window actually coalesces rapid content pushes from the Quillmark CMS. The thresholds we agreed on in the review are listed below.

tuning constants:
RATE_LIMITS = {
    "holix": 1,
    "oliwyn": 5,
}

## Approvals: Descriptor Leak Hunt (Project Wrenfall)

New folks: any patch touching the Wrenfall socket pool during the leaked-file-descriptor hunt needs explicit sign-off before merge. Attach lsof snapshots from before and after your change, and note the reproduction steps in the ticket. Sign-off authority for all descriptor-hunt changes rests with the engineer named below.

account owner for fajep-yagef: Kasix Eliiel

**Q: My plugin leaks memory via the GlintCache image store?**

Known issue in SDK 3.2: bitmaps pinned by plugin callbacks never get evicted. Fix: release handles in onDetach, or upgrade to 3.3. If your plugin signing account got suspended during the purge, recover it yourself. The recovery passphrase is below.

strongbox words: zormir-quenath-sorax